Summary

Joseph Metcalf School is a public middle school in Holyoke, MA, serving 205 students in grades 6-8. The school is part of the Holyoke school district, which is ranked 348 out of 348 districts in Massachusetts and is rated 0 stars out of 5 by SchoolDigger.

The data analysis suggests that Joseph Metcalf School is struggling to provide a high-quality education to its students, particularly in core academic areas like English Language Arts and Mathematics. The school consistently performs below the state and district averages on MCAS Next Generation assessments, with only 11.44% of students proficient or better in ELA and just 3.96% proficient or better in Mathematics in the 2024-2025 school year. The school's performance is particularly concerning for certain student subgroups, ranking in the bottom 25% of Massachusetts middle schools for Hispanic students, English Language Learners, and students with special needs.

When compared to nearby middle schools, such as Michael E. Smith Middle School in South Hadley and Dupont Middle in Chicopee, Joseph Metcalf School's performance is significantly lower, with proficiency rates that are nearly double or triple those of Joseph Metcalf School. This suggests a systemic issue within the Holyoke school district, as the two other middle schools in the district, Holyoke STEM Academy and Lt Clayre Sullivan Elementary, also perform poorly on MCAS assessments.
